[Twisted-Python] Hanging test cases (Was: Evangelism notes...)

Grant Baillie grant at osafoundation.org
Thu May 5 17:44:46 EDT 2005


On May 5, 2005, at 12:26 PM, Bob Ippolito wrote:

>> I'm not sure if this is a problem in python, in twisted's use of  
>> threading, or in trial.deferredResult, though.
>>
>
> Almost definitely a combination of 2 and 3, with 3 being the one  
> really at fault.  Trial is horribly, horribly broken by design and  
> it's really just an accident that it works at all.  The  
> expectations a lot of the tests have about the reactor are also  
> broken, but that's mostly just a consequence of trial sucking.

Thanks for the info. I'll go ahead and file a bug, unless someone  
tells me not to. FWIW, I'm happy with my workaround (I'm really only  
using it to keep my doc/unittests relatively uncomplicated).

--Grant

Grant Baillie
Open Source Applications Foundation
http://www.osafoundation.org







More information about the Twisted-Python mailing list